Recap: Wellsboro Hornets vs. Mansfield Tigers
The Wellsboro Hornets won against the Mansfield Tigers on Friday with 46 points and they decided to stick to that point total again on Friday. Wellsboro managed a 46-40 win over Mansfield. The victory was familiar territory for Wellsboro who now have three in a row.
Several Tigers players turned in solid performances, despite ultimately coming up short. Perhaps the best among those players was Karson Dominick, who scored 20 points. Dominick scored a full 50% of Mansfield's points, the seventh time in a row he's earned more than a third of the team's points. The team also got some help courtesy of Cooper Shaw, who scored 12 points along with eight rebounds.
Wellsboro pushed their record up to 5-2 with that win, which was their third straight at home. Those good results were due in large part to their offensive dominance across that stretch, as they averaged 50.3 points per game. As for Mansfield, their defeat ended a four-game streak of away wins and brought them to 7-3.
Wellsboro will look to defend their home court on Monday against Jersey Shore at 7:30 p.m. Jersey Shore will have to bring their A-game into this one, as they are staring down a pretty big deficit in the MaxPreps Pennsylvania Rankings (they are ranked 632nd, while Wellsboro is ranked 283rd). Mansfield's road trip will continue as they head out to face Wyalusing Valley at 7:30 p.m. on January 10th. Wyalusing Valley is coming into the game on a six-game losing streak.
